Aprio’s Structured Products Group is a specialized team of capital markets and accounting professionals that provide assurance and advisory services for a critical element of structured finance bond issuance. The team delivers Agreed Upon Procedures (AUP) and other reports, principally for new-issue asset backed securities and securitizations. The team works with a national network of lenders, investment banks, and asset managers.

The Structured Products ABS modeler is responsible for the independent modeling of each AUP engagement: recreating asset and bond (liability) cash flows using modeling assumptions and the payment waterfall from the offering documents and legal agreements and helping to identify and explain any discrepancies.

Position Responsibilities:

  • Model and recalculate cash flows — independently rebuild asset and liability (bond) cash flows for ABS transactions, reverse-engineering the payment waterfall from offering documents and legal agreements. Recreate and analyze customized investor scenarios and interface with the investment bank to discuss the results.
  • Analyze the collateral — perform loan pool analysis, collateral stratification, and legal document review to support each AUP report.
  • Tie out the results — review model output, identify discrepancies, and help explain them so the report ties out accurately before closing.
  • Deliver as a team — work with teammates on all aspects of the AUP report creation and delivery process, coordinating with internal and external parties.
  • Run the modeling workstream — manage the modeling on a live deal, including client communication and the timing of deliverables.
  • Improve how the work gets done — help develop and refine workflow processes, including documenting procedures to support efficient, accurate deliverables.
  • Communicate clearly — verbally and in writing, with clients and with all levels of the organization.
